About this episode
Dr Chatterjee talks to elite sports sleep coach and author of the book Sleep: The Myth of 8 Hours, the Power of Naps... and the New Plan to Recharge Your Body and Mind about his unique journey to coaching world famous sports teams, on improving performance through sleep patterns and on daily actionable tips for everyone.
